Aimee Mann Announces Lost in Space Anniversary Tour
Aimee Mann has announced a special new tour celebrating the “22nd 1/2 anniversary” of her 2002 album Lost in Space. Fittingly, the songwriter will perform tunes from the album at each performance, bringing along frequent […]